Ticket QRT-5519: Parcelgram webhook rejecting all deliveries with SIGNATURE_MISMATCH since last night's rotation. Cause: the Swiftbin consumer still verifies against the retired key; the new one never reached the vault sync. Impact: tracking updates delayed ~6h, retries queued. Fix: update the verifier config, replay the dead-letter queue, confirm HMAC matches on three sample payloads. For new folks: rotations always need a manual vault push. Current signing key for the webhook follows.

deploy key for kajof-fajop: bky6_gDHw9Q

This page summarises churn in the Lanterhill pilot through month four. Of the forty-one accounts onboarded, seven have lapsed, concentrated in the smaller Westbrook-tier customers. Exit interviews point to onboarding friction rather than pricing; the Quenby dashboard rollout addressed most of the reported gaps. Finance should note that churn-adjusted revenue remains within the original model's tolerance. Pell is tracking the recovery offers and will update monthly. The restricted note on forward plans is recorded below this line.

management briefing: Eliaxax Works is in early talks to buy Casoxox Systems for about $61.5 million. The Framir launch date is May 17, and nothing goes to the press before then.

For this week's sync: cold starts on the Quillfast serverless handlers have been averaging 2.1 seconds, mostly from dependency initialization and certificate loading. This migration step introduces a provisioned warm pool plus lazy-loading of the report module, which in canary testing cut cold-start latency to under 400 milliseconds. Before rolling this to the remaining regions, each handler group must be redeployed with the warm-pool parameters applied. The settings we validated in canary are the following.

service settings:
druael:
  pin: 7528
  metrics_host: metrics.druael.lumiclabs.internal
  tenant: wendor
  seal: seal_c765840a

**Q: How do we run schema migrations on Lanternbase without downtime?**

A: Every migration is expand-contract. First we add new columns or tables alongside the old ones, deploy application code that writes to both, backfill in throttled batches, then flip reads, and only later drop the legacy structures. Support should never advise customers to pause traffic. If a backfill job halts mid-run, the on-call engineer resumes it from the checkpoint console, which unlocks with the recovery passphrase shown below.

vault phrase of bagaf-kajeg = jorath-feniel-briir-siliel-ralix